VIA home is a Consumer Packaged Goods organization based in United States, with around 350 employees and annual revenues of $40.0 million.

VIA home operates a diverse technology stack with applications such as Google Workspace (Formerly Google G-Suite) and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ise, covering areas like Collaboration and ERP Financial.

VIA home has invested in cloud applications and AI-driven platforms to optimize efficiency and growth, collaborating with vendors such as Google and Intuit.

VIA home recently adopted applications including Google Workspace (Formerly Google G-Suite) in 2013 and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ise in 2009, highlighting its ongoing modernization strategy.
